Third meeting of the Future Earth Science Committee and Engagement Committee
The meeting taking place this week is the third in-person meeting of the Science Committee and first of the full Engagement Committee, which was announced in November. It brings together 29 members of both Committees, as well as members of interim Secretariat, the new Secretariat implementation team and Future Earth's sponsors, the Science and Technology Alliance for Global Sustainability.
Discussions have focused on taking forward the Future Earth 2025 Vision, looking at the structures and activities that will help address the global challenges outlined in the Vision.
